In the complex field of environmental chemistry, catalysts act as crucial enablers, significantly amplifying the power of ozone to degrade persistent organic pollutants.
Ozone, while a strong oxidant, often requires assistance to effectively break down highly recalcitrant molecules. Catalysts, particularly heterogeneous types, facilitate this by promoting the formation of hydroxyl radicals (•OH), which are far more reactive and less selective than ozone itself. This acceleration of the oxidation process leads to higher degradation rates, improved mineralization of organic contaminants, and ultimately, cleaner discharged water. When evaluating industrial catalyst suppliers, several key factors should be considered. These include the supplier's technical expertise, the consistency of their product quality, their capacity for reliable supply, and their ability to provide technical support. A good supplier will offer catalysts tailored to specific industrial needs, whether it's for textile effluent, pharmaceutical waste, or petrochemical by-products.
